United National Party (UNP) Deputy Leader Minister Sajith Premadasa has opined that the UNP-led alliance must be formed after announcing the Presidential candidate.
Issuing a statement, Mr. Premadasa stated that doing so would encourage more individuals and parties to join the UNP-led Democratic National Front (DNF) alliance.
The Minister said he believes that this is the stance of a majority of UNP Parliamentarians and the other parties which have expressed willingness to join the alliance.
The launch of the DNF alliance targetting the upcoming elections was expected to take place on August 5 but had been delayed due to disagreement within the UNP on its proposed constitution.
